Emerson Electric Co. is a global technology and engineering company that provides innovative solutions for customers in various industries, including commercial and residential solutions, industrial automation, and climate technologies.

Emerson Political Contributions and Lobbying Profile

Emerson Electric's OpenSecrets profile reveals that in the 2024 cycle the company made political contributions totaling $146,090 and spent $720,000 on lobbying. Additionally, a notable revolving door is evident with 5 out of 6 lobbyists in 2023 and 1 out of 1 in 2024 having held government positions, raising concerns about corporate influence and potential regulatory capture.

    In the case Yaschuk v Emerson Electric Canada Limited, the Human Rights Tribunal of Alberta awarded $50,000 in damages after a prolonged period of workplace sexual harassment and a dismissive internal investigation. The decision highlights the employer's failure to protect employee rights and conduct a thorough inquiry into the misconduct.
